The Naginata is a traditional Japanese weapon. It is essentially a blade attached to a pole, similar to a spear but still quite different. The weapon was originally wielded by the Samurai and the Warrior Monks (sōhei), as well as foot soldiers in the past. However, it garnered its iconic status in the hands of the female warriors in pre-modern Japan’s bushi class, named the Onna-musha.

Yasuke’s Naginata Skill Tree Explained
Yasuke has six different Skill Trees, and the Naginata tree is only one part of it. It consists of six different ranks and various ability types, such as Global Passive, Weapon Passive, and Weapon Active. Each tier will require a specific number of Knowledge Points, and every ability will need the required Mastery Points to unlock.
